The Maze Runner by James Dashner is about a teenage boy named Thomas. Thomas gets sent to a mysterious maze where he has no memory of his past life. Thomas is not the only kid who was sent there. Soon after he arrived he joined the group of all of the kids and became the lead maze runner. Time goes by fighting to get out of the never changing maze and finally, they find a way out.

myahlebleu@gmail.com The theme of The Maze Runner is the key to survive which is persistence. I rate this book a 5/5 because very rarely in the book did it become confusing. It was straight forward the whole book. The book kept me intrigued and curious to what would happen next. I highly recommend this book to teenagers who love mystery and action books. Overall this book has been one of my favourite books to read, I love action and mysteries. 2y
myahlebleu@gmail.com The Maze Runner is written in third person limited. Thomas is not telling the story himself but the readers feel as if he is and feels his emotions. 2y

End Game is about this boy named Nick. Nick gets into a car accident and was in the hospital afterwards while his memory was blank. He is aware of that is going on around him but he cannot communicate himself. He is trying to recover lost memories. I give this book a 3 out of 5 stars because it is a well written book but It is not my book I would chose to read. I would recommend this book to people who love mysteries and dad, son relationships.
